Last chance to sign up for the inaugural Northstowe Half Marathon and Fullscope 5k
The inaugural Northstowe Half Marathon and Fullscope 5k – supported by the Cambridge Independent and Cambridge 105 – takes place this Sunday (April 24) and anyone wishing to take part has until midnight tonight (Wednesday, April 20) to sign up.
All profits from the 5k will be donated to Fullscope, a consortium of organisations supporting the mental health and wellbeing of children and young people in Cambridgeshire and Peterborough. These include Blue Smile, Centre 33, CPSL Mind, Arts & Minds and others.
The event has been organised by the same team behind last September’s successful Northstowe Running Festival, also backed by the Cambridge Independent. Marcin Lis, founder and managing director of the festival, said: “We’re promoting this one separately to the Running Festival in September.
“We wanted to target specifically something that we’d like to support so we chose to support children and young people’s mental health and wellbeing. Two of the charities involved are engaged directly with the event and with the fundraising effort – Blue Smile and Centre 33.”
The races start and finish at Northstowe Secondary College. The half-marathon will begin at 9.30am, with the Fullscope 5k following about 15 minutes later. They are both single lap course with chip timing events. Sign up at northstowehalf.co.uk.
